What it is
- Tendai sect temple, founded in the late 7th century.
- Main image is Yakushi Nyorai.
- 5th sacred site of Banshu Yakushi.
- Only Hakuho temple in former Akashi County.
What to see
- Main hall built during the Genna era.
- Main hall is Akashi City's oldest temple architecture.
- Main hall is a Hyogo Prefectural Tangible Cultural Property.
- Seated Yakushi Nyorai statue from the late Heian period.
- Taidera廃寺 pagoda site is a Hyogo Prefectural Historic Site.
- Taidera廃寺 site is estimated to be 100 meters square.
